Transaction 11105c6139103dcd28b85b8718d4cbc036686e7d908d3ca9bf41baf7243fac85
1 Input
1 Output
-
11105c6139103dcd28b85b8718d4cbc036686e7d908d3ca9bf41baf7243fac85:0
- value
- 420670
- script pubkey
- OP_0 OP_PUSHBYTES_20 940727d775fa4a70652df156fb5144ab3c70b30f
- address
- bc1qjsrj04m4lf98qefd79t0k52y4v78pvc04a4ycx